The Stellantis Cassino plant production shutdown has been extended after the automaker temporarily suspended operations because of insufficient customer orders. According to multiple reports published on June 26, the manufacturing facility in Italy will halt activity across several key production departments from June 26 through July 3, 2026. The decision reflects continued demand challenges affecting vehicle production at the site and further highlights the difficult operating environment faced by the plant during the first half of the year.

Production Operations Suspended Until Early July

The temporary production stoppage covers the plant's primary manufacturing functions, including the body shop, paint shop, assembly line, and associated operational departments. With these areas remaining idle throughout the scheduled shutdown period, production activities at the Cassino facility will be paused until July 3, 2026. The suspension was implemented because of a shortage of incoming orders, making it necessary for the company to temporarily stop manufacturing operations.

Historic Low Production Activity in 2026

The latest shutdown adds to an already difficult year for the Cassino manufacturing site. During the first half of 2026, the facility recorded only 32 working days, representing the lowest operational level in its history. The reduced production schedule underscores the significant impact that declining order volumes have had on the plant's manufacturing performance, with limited operating days reflecting ongoing challenges in maintaining normal production activity.
